Police are appealing for information after a man was stabbed in the back in Ewell

The victim was walking with a friend across the island of grass in the middle of Gadesden Road, towards Alway Avenue between 10pm and 11pm on July 26 when he was approached by a group of four men.

The men spoke to the victim, before attacking him. During the assault the victim was knifed in the back.

He managed to escaped into Alway Avenue and the men made off. The victim made his own way to hospital, where his injuries have been described as serious but not life threatening.

The four suspects are all described as white, wearing dark clothing and face coverings.

Two of the men are believed to have left on a motorcycle that was parked in Baker Place.

The third man is described as white, 5’10”-6’, in his early 20s. He had a scraggly dark beard. He was wearing a dark baseball cab pulled very low on his face. A dark hooded top and dark tracksuit bottoms.

The fourth man is described as white, 5’6” tall, approximately 20 years old. He had short dark hair which was shorter at the sides and back and was wearing a white t-shirt.
